From 72fc40ea490171fd13ed50b9d110a879f3699e70 Mon Sep 17 00:00:00 2001 From: bbaban <3102509561@qq.com> Date: Tue, 10 Oct 2023 12:24:37 +0800 Subject: [PATCH] fix --- plugins/genshin/model/mys/mysApi.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/plugins/genshin/model/mys/mysApi.js b/plugins/genshin/model/mys/mysApi.js index b582fe7..1d1878c 100644 --- a/plugins/genshin/model/mys/mysApi.js +++ b/plugins/genshin/model/mys/mysApi.js @@ -69,14 +69,14 @@ export default class MysApi { } async getData(type, data = {}, cached = false, isGetFP = false) { - if (!isGetFP && !this.device_fp && !data?.headers['x-rpc-device_fp']) { + if (!isGetFP && !this.device_fp && !data?.headers?.['x-rpc-device_fp']) { let seed_id = this.generateSeed(16) let device_fp = await this.getData('getFp', { seed_id }, false, true) this.device_fp = device_fp?.data?.device_fp } - if (!isGetFP && this.device_fp && !data?.headers['x-rpc-device_fp']) { + if (!isGetFP && this.device_fp && !data?.headers?.['x-rpc-device_fp']) { if (data?.headers) { data.headers['x-rpc-device_fp'] = this.device_fp } else {